Annabelle doll handler and paranormal investigator Dan Rivera’s cause of death revealed

Dan Rivera, the paranormal investigator who was touring alongside the infamous and purportedly ‘haunted’ Annabelle doll, was found dead in July shortly after attending an event in Gettysburg, Pennsylvania. The Army Veteran served as the senior lead investigator for the New England Society for Psychic Research. He died on July 13, with authorities now confirming the cause of his death. Paranormal investigator Dan Rivera died on July 13, shortly after an event in Gettysburg. Dutrow stated, “Mr. Rivera had a known hory of cardiac issues, which were consent with the findings. It is also confirmed that Annabelle was not present in the room at the time of his passing,” as reported the PEOPLE. A July 13 report from the Pennsylvania State Police outlined the circumstances surrounding the discovery of the 54-year-old. The report read, “Members from PSP Gettysburg responded to a hotel in Straban Township, Adams County for a report of a deceased [man]. The decedent was discovered in his hotel room workers.” It added, “Nothing unusual or suspicious was observed at the scene.” The Adam County coroner previously told the news outlet that Rivera was with his colleagues in the morning but went to his room as he was feeling sick. It was not revealed what he was feeling ill with. At the time of his death, he was on tour with the doll was described as “demonically possessed” the New England Society for Psychic Research. About the ‘haunted’ Annabelle dollThe Annabelle doll’s origin goes back to 1968, when she was gifted to a student nurse who allegedly brought the toy to her apartment, which she rented with her roommate. The society shared, “Almost immediately, the roommates noticed strange occurrences with the doll and they were introduced to a medium who told them the doll was inhabited the spirit of a young girl named Annabelle,” as reported PEOPLE. They added, “The two roommates tried to accept the doll’s spirit and please it only to have it reciprocate maliciousness and violent intent.” The founders of the society and popular paranormal investigators, Ed and Lorraine Warren, removed the doll from the apartment and locked it inside a glass box “to contain the evil-spirited entity.” The Conjuring film franchise is inspired the Warrens and the Annabelle doll.
